On 17 Apr 2001, at 16:27, Kevin Howlett wrote: > Anybody ever restored a Fuel Tank? Rust only happens in there when there is water with the gas. If you don't have much rust, I'd leave it alone and just fix the source of the problem which is bound to be the overflow hose on the rear side of the filler pipe. These are almost always cracked and they will leak gas out and wheel spray (water) in.
